gpt4 book ai didi

php - 如何学习 Zend 框架?

转载 作者:可可西里 更新时间:2023-10-31 22:16:16 26 4
gpt4 key购买 nike

我已经与 zend 框架斗争了很长一段时间。问题不在于 PHP 本身,而在于这些无数的类以及它们之间的关系。例如:我开始阅读这个:http://framework.zend.com/manual/en/learning.layout.usage.html一切都很好,直到作者提到以下内容:要初始化 Zend_Layout,请将以下内容添加到您的配置文件中

 resources.layout.layoutPath = APPLICATION_PATH "/layouts/scripts"
resources.layout.layout = "layout"

现在的问题是为什么要这样做?我觉得我只是在复制粘贴而没有任何真正的解释。然后他开始使用:

  $this->layout()->content

我喜欢哇!!!等一下,这个 layout() 方法在哪里,我一直在追逐这些方法和类,直到我头晕目眩并放弃。

我感觉我正在以错误的方式接近它(zend 框架)。谁能给我一个接近 Zend 框架的最佳方法的想法?同样,它与 PHP 无关,而更多地与对象之间的关系有关。

我觉得我正在钻研一团面的类(class)请帮忙???

最佳答案

我的观点是框架的学习曲线比普通的 php 更陡峭,尤其是对于 zend。如果你有时间并且我会建议你从一个非常小的 mvc 开始,你最好去学习一个你可以自己构建的非常小的 mvc 的教程。

这应该很容易做到,稍微试验一下,(甚至更多地扩展它)并习惯 mvc 哲学,我相信当你回到 zend 时事情会容易得多。

====================已编辑========================= =======

很喜欢这个,收藏了here .理解理论是一回事,当您说“我知道这个小的 mvc 需要什么才能变得伟大......” 是另一回事。至于zend,你可以主要是随着新需求的出现,这样你就不会累,知识永无止境,我们也有生活要过!

现在直接进入类代码,会很困难。 Zend 有很多文档,您可以从中受益,因为它会一步步引导您。

关于php - 如何学习 Zend 框架?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7746938/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com